Staffordshire Good Food Awards

The warmest welcome … the finest dining … the tastiest flavours … the best cup of tea … the Staffordshire Good Food Awards are held each year to celebrate quality and distinctiveness
in the food and drink that is produced and served in Staffordshire.

All of the dining venues which entered the awards scheme are marked with the symbol Taste of Staffordshire Entrant in our where to eat listing. This indicates that they have all been visited by professionally qualified restaurant inspectors who judge all aspects of their visit including quality of food and drink, service, presentation and use of local produce. The final winners are only decided after two separate mystery visits.
The 2007 winners are:-

 

Restaurant of the Year (European influence)

1st Pascal at The Old Vicarage, Burton upon Trent
2nd The Moat House, Acton Trussell
3rd The Riversholme Restaurant, Rocester

 

Restaurant of the Year (Non-European and Asian influence)

1st Bombay Club Restaurant, Stoke-on-Trent
2nd Mango Tree Indian Restaurant, Stonnall
3rd Peaches, Newcastle Under Lyme

 

Brasserie of the Year

1st Brasserie at The Shoes, Blackshaw Moor, Leek
2nd Brasserie at The Swan Hotel, Stafford
3rd The Dial Bar Restaurant, Burton upon Trent

 

Pub of the Year

1st The Bell Inn, Anslow
2nd Fox & Goose, Foxt
3rd The Tavern Inn, Denstone

 

Tea Room of the Year

1st Ramblers' Retreat, Alton
2nd Café Davide, Leek
3rd White Hart Tea Room, Leek

 

Visitor Attraction of the Year

1st Eden Day Spa, Hoar Cross
2nd Silks Restaurant, Uttoxeter Race Course
3rd The Stables Restaurant, Weston Park

 

Banqueting Venue of the Year

1st Weston Park
2nd Jenkinson's at the County Showground
3rd Weston Hall, Stafford

 

NFU Award for Best Use of Local Produce

1st Essington Fruit Farm, nr Wolverhampton
2nd Amerton Farm & Craft Centre, Stowe-by-Chartley
3rd The Meynell Ingram Arms, Hoar Cross

 

Best Newcomer

Fox & Goose, Foxt

 

Steelite Award “Passion to Inspire"

Granville's, Stone

 

Service Science Personal Award for Outstanding Service

Olga Baker, Peaches Restaurant, Newcastle-under-Lyme

 

Highly commended:

Robert Mitchell, Jenkinson's at Silks Restaurant, Uttoxeter Race Course

 

Award for Continuous Achievement

Greystones 17th Century Tea Room
